Club Dive - Night Dive Breakwater 7-20-24

Derek Suring | Published on 7/23/2024

We had ten divers on our first dive starting around 7pm at Breakwater. Overcast skies and a setting sun set the fish into their crevices for a night rest. Visibility was moderate, 15' at the best. Water temperature was balmy, readings of 58 to 61 degrees, though many of us found very significant thermoclines starting around 35'.

Lingcod, Cabezon, Rockfish and a plethora of freshly laid egg ribbons were evident. We scoured for a sighting of an Octopus but they proved elusive.

A second group of three divers went back in for another 9:30pm dive. Report forthcoming.
